The Interior Design Program offers three certificate and three degree options designed to meet the needs of students seeking to become an interior designer, kitchen and bath designer, manager of an interior design firm, or industry specializing-professional among the vast variety of interior design disciplines. Interior Design: Kitchen and Bath AAS degree graduates are qualified to take the Associate Kitchen and Bath Design certification exam, AKBD, after completing one year of work experience. The JCCC Interior Design Program provides relevant curriculum with experiential learning that emphasizes the student’s ability to think creatively, critically, and collaboratively in preparation of entering professional employment. Theory and application dovetail in the classroom and community, providing exposure to business and industry standards, professional practices, and progressive design opportunities through cultivated industry relationships. Two required internships help develop technical, creative and business skills.  JCCC's interior design program is recognized by the National Kitchen and Bath Association as an NKBA Accredited program.

Faculty have worked in the field, which equips them to offer valuable firsthand knowledge of what it takes to succeed.

Note: Some prerequisite courses for the Interior Design programs require a “C” or higher to be awarded the AAS degrees and certificates.
